Details
A vulnerability was found in Gadu-Gadu Instant Messenger 7.20 (Messaging Software). It has been rated as problematic. This issue affects an unknown functionality.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a denial of service vulnerability. Using CWE to declare the problem leads to CWE-404. The product does not release or incorrectly releases a resource before it is made available for re-use. Impacted is availability. The summary by CVE is:
Gadu-Gadu 7.20 does not properly handle MS-DOS device names in filenames, which allows remote attackers to (1) cause a denial of service (hang) via an image filename of AUX: sent twice (hang), or (2) write to the LPT1 port via a filename of "LPT1:".
The weakness was released 11/21/2005 by Blazej Miga and Jaroslaw Sajko as confirmed posting (Bugtraq). The advisory is shared at marc.theaimsgroup.com. The identification of this vulnerability is CVE-2005-3887 since 11/29/2005. The exploitation is known to be difficult. The attack may be initiated remotely. No form of authentication is needed for a successful exploitation. Neither technical details nor an exploit are publicly available.
The vulnerability is also documented in the databases at X-Force (23148), SecurityFocus (BID 15520†), OSVDB (21015†) and Secunia (SA17597†).
